Xclsve Hstric Sburb Clontarf, Clse 5k Dtwn N Bch Bay Rst Bar
Beautiful fully modernised 4 bedroom house with all mod cons, private garden /deck . South facing kitchen with dining area and sunroom.T.V, room and sitting room. Downstairs and upstairs bathrooms.Master bedroom ensuite with double bed,second bedroom with double bed, third bedroom with bunk beds,fourth bedroom with single bed downstairs.Sleeper sofa in sitting room.

About the area
Dublin
Located near the beach, this holiday home is in Clontarf, a neighbourhood in Dublin. Dublin Port and Guinness Storehouse are worth checking out if an activity is on the agenda, while those in the mood for shopping can visit O'Connell Street and Grafton Street. Looking to enjoy an event or a game? See what's going on at Croke Park or Aviva Stadium. Discover the area's water adventures with sailing and swimming nearby, or enjoy the great outdoors with hiking/biking trails and cycling.

Where is Xclsve Hstric Sburb Clontarf, Clse 5k Dtwn N Bch Bay Rst Bar located?
Located in Clontarf, this holiday home is steps from Clontarf Castle and within 3 mi (5 km) of Dublin Port and Croke Park. St Anne's Park and 3Arena are also within 3 miles (5 km). Dublin Killester Station is 16 minutes by foot and Dublin Clontarf Road Station is 22 minutes.

We had a lovely stay at this home in Clontarf. It’s spacious, cozy and well-equipped. The hosts were communicative and easy to get in touch with. The home is in a beautiful neighborhood and felt very safe. It is also quite convenient - We were able to walk to the grocery store, the Castle (for dinner/drinks) and the bus stop within about 5 minutes. The 130 bus took us directly into Dublin for 2-3 euro per person (20-40 min ride depending on which side of the Liffy you choose). Taxis are also easy to get and cost 25-30 euro to do the same. The house has 3 bedrooms upstairs and 2 downstairs - plenty of space to spread out. And the patio is lovely - the perfect spot for coffee/tea/cards. I was debating whether to get a hotel/small condo in the city, so as to be close to the action, or to stay further out and enjoy some space. So glad we chose this home!Things to note:There is not air conditioning but even in July this was not an issue as the weather is quite temperate and you can sleep with the windows open. There is a control panel for the hot water heater both downstairs and a switch upstairs in the primary. It’s simple to use once you know how to work it but make sure you get instruction on this. This house uses traditional keys and the doors lock behind you so keep a set on you at all time. We never had an issue locking ourselves out but it is something to be aware of. Short story - stop looking elsewhere and stay here!

First off, the location is perfect for walks and public transit. Just 5 mins to small parks and the waterfront promenade; 20-30 mins to larger parks and Dublin city center (depending on where in city center, may be more like 45). Buses and taxis are convenient, great local shops, food, and grocery just a few blocks away.
Second, the property is an ideal rental. The house is huge by Dublin living standards, and while the decor might be a little quirky (“cottage shabby chic” comes to mind), it made us feel a bit more at home knowing that if a cup or plate had a mishap, we weren’t destroying a perfectly planned set. We had 4 adults and 2 toddlers, but with an occasional overnight guest from Dublin as well during our stay - it can easily accommodate 2-4 more depending on your bed needs. The house also has all of those perfect “oh I forgot that” items (umbrellas? Baby toys? Vacation reading? Ireland tour books?) and a very well-appointed kitchen for a rental, which came in handy for us!
Finally, the hosts were amazing - Peter and Gay greeted one of our relatives for the key handoff, Catherina was great with correspondence and questions, and when we did have a minor problem with an appliance, someone was there to fix it within a couple of hours.
One of my favorite things about the house is that it’s suited to any weather - helpful in unpredictable Dublin if you’re planning to spend at the house during your stay. The covered outdoor area was wonderful to keep us outside even through a sprinkle/mist/downpour in warmer weather, and the indoor sunroom warmly cheered us up when it was cold and blustery.
